My 3,200-hour receipt (bought at $19.99 in 2021)

Not a review — a receipt. Bought at this exact price during Summer Sale 2021. Here’s the ledger:

Year Hours Primary Mode Notable
2021 800 Official vanilla Learned the hard way — wiped 47 times
2022 1,100 Modded (2x, 3x, 5x) Ran own server for friends
2023 900 Official + modded mix Oil rig / helicopter meta
2024 400 Console (PS5) cross-play test Controller viable but disadvantaged

Total cost: $19.99 for 3,200 hours = $0.006/hr. Cheapest entertainment per hour I’ve ever bought.

Key lessons from 3,200 hours:
Solo is viable but masochistic — 200+ hours to reach competency. Duo/trio is the sweet spot.
Wipes are the game — Monthly forced wipes (first Thursday) reset everything. This is a feature, not a bug.
Console vs PC — PS5/Xbox versions exist ($39.99, rarely on sale). Cross-play with PC but no mouse = aim disadvantage. PC at $19.99 is the better buy.
Modded servers change everything — 2x/3x/5x gather, instant craft, kits, remove components. Cuts learning curve by 80%.

What you’re buying

The definitive multiplayer survival sandbox. You wake naked on a beach. Gather wood/stone → build base → research tech tree → raid others → get raided → repeat. Monthly forced wipes reset the map. No win condition — you make your own goals.

Key facts:
Dev/Publisher: Facepunch Studios (Garry Newman)
Launched: Feb 2018 (Early Access Dec 2013), 8+ years of updates
Steam rating: 95% Positive (2,100,000+ reviews) — “Overwhelmingly Positive” recent
Playtime: No upper bound. 100 hrs to “learn,” 1000+ to “master” (HowLongToBeat)
Platforms: Windows/macOS/Linux native. Steam Deck: Unsupported (Easy Anti-Cheat)
Anti-cheat: Easy Anti-Cheat (kernel-level). Blocks Steam Deck, Linux Proton requires workarounds

Game modes:
Official — Vanilla, monthly wipe, 100-500 pop, harsh but fair
Community — Modded rates (2x-10x), custom maps, kits, plugins
Softcore / Hardcore — Team size limits, BP wipe schedules, roleplay variants

FAQ

Does it have single-player / offline? No. Pure multiplayer. Community servers with 2x rates + “solo/duo/trio” limits are the closest to solo-friendly.

Steam Deck verified? No. Easy Anti-Cheat blocks it. GeForce Now / cloud gaming works but adds subscription cost + latency.

Mac / Linux? No. Facepunch dropped macOS in 2023. Linux/Proton blocked by EAC.

DLC / microtransactions? Cosmetic skins only (Steam marketplace). No gameplay DLC. All content free.

Wipe schedule? First Thursday of every month, 2 PM EST. Map + blueprints reset. Plan your start accordingly.
